People Loving Nashville was established in 2008 when a group of friends shared several hot meals with some individuals living on the streets on a cold Thanksgiving night. The experience changed something in them, and they continued to bring supper downtown once a month. Once a month soon turned into a weekly tradition. From a two-burner stove in a bachelor pad to a commercially-outfitted kitchen at church, we have continued to grow and expand, learning and maturing along the way, all against the backdrop of friendship.
Our skilled staff and trained volunteers seek to form relationships that bring a Christ-centered, evidence-based pathway to sustainable hope, healing, and restoration. We begin the process by assembling meals, preparing clothing and supplies for distribution to hundreds, and provide emergency response to serve the suffering of our city in public spaces, low-income apartment complexes, homeless camps, and more, every weekday.

4 Pillars Of Sustainable Impact
Relief
-
We offer meals, clothing, survival supplies, and resource navigation to the unhoused and those most at-risk in Nashville.
Whether someone needs a warm coat, a safe meal, or guidance toward housing and health services, we are here to meet immediate needs while building relationships that lead to long-term restoration.
Community
-
We’ve built a culture rooted in love, dignity, and consistency. Our team is trained to build trust, offer support, and help our friends envision life beyond homelessness.
That same intentionality shapes our volunteer culture—through retreats, dinners, and discipleship, we create space for growth, connection, and long-term commitment.
Connection
-
We bridge the gap between those in need and those who can help, believing transformation begins with real connection. Together, we move people from homelessness to homefullness…building emotional, physical, and spiritual health.
Our volunteers and trusted community partners help make this possible, offering services like weekly relief outreach, healthcare, counseling, veterinarian support, housing support, and more, so that no one has to walk this journey alone.
Restoration
-
Our coffee shop Paradeisos helps restore lives by providing employment that offers dignity and healing to a person familiar with homelessness and the hardships of life.
Our restoration program focuses on emotional healing, access to low-barrier jobs, and building relationships that lead to lasting stability.
